A tooth crown is often needed to protect a tooth that has been broken or to cover a dental implant post in order to look and perform like a real tooth. When there is enough remaining healthy tooth to affix the dental crown to, a dental implant is not needed. Often, if the broken tooth has exposed the soft portion that covers the nerve and allowed it to become a cavity, endodontic< surgery may be necessary before the dental crown can be placed.

Porcelain Tooth Crowns

At Woodlands Premier Dentistry, Houston cosmetic dentist Dr. Scott Young only uses porcelain dental crowns. Some dental practices use composite crowns over a metal base, which can create problems when the metal expands and contracts. It may also create the appearance of discoloration if the metal shows through the composite. An all-porcelain crown can help avoid these pitfalls and provide a natural- and healthy-looking tooth instead of an obvious crown.

Other benefits of porcelain crowns include:

  • They can be tinted and shaped to look exactly like natural teeth
  • They respond to teeth whitening like natural teeth do
  • They more easily enable Dr. Young to detect structural problems in the underlying tooth

How Tooth Crowns Work

A tooth crown differs from other dental installations in that it completely encases the tooth. Porcelain veneers only cover the front of the tooth and sometimes the biting edge. Other restorations, such as fillings and porcelain inlays and onlays, cover only the part of the tooth which has been damaged. Because a tooth crown covers the entire tooth, the tooth itself must be shaped and some of the enamel removed to allow the crown to fit over it while still correctly interacting with its neighboring and opposing teeth.

A tooth crown may be necessary for a:

  • Broken tooth
  • Cracked tooth
  • Decayed tooth
  • Tooth with a damaged root
